My daughter has a pixel 6a and over the last 6 months or so has recorded a few videos on there.
Because of this, she has filled up 15gb of storage on her Google drive.
I have deleted a few of the videos, but it still shows an error if she tries to send an email - encourages her to increase the storage for a fee.
How can I convince the phone that there is a lot of space on the Google drive now? Is it a case of waiting whilst Gmail catches up?

There are 2 bins.
One for files on Google Drive.
Another for photos and videos in Google Photos.
Both count towards the total storage on the account.
Both bins clear deleted items 30 days after deletion, but you can clear both manually too. Only after permanent deletion (automatic or manual) is the storage freed up on the account.
The link below should hopefully show what's using storage on the account;
